Buyers often search specifically for bungalow-style homes because more frequently used rooms may be located on one level. The actual arrangement should still be reviewed for every Coventry Hills property.
A bungalow designation describes the general structure of the home. It does not establish that the property is accessible, barrier-free or suitable for a particular mobility requirement.
Some bungalows may have fewer bedrooms above grade because additional bedrooms or living areas have been developed in the basement. Buyers should distinguish between main-floor and lower-level rooms when comparing properties.
If long-term main-floor living is part of the purchase decision, consider whether the existing bedroom and bathroom arrangement meets those needs without depending on future renovations.
Basement development can substantially affect the functionality of a Coventry Hills bungalow. Depending on the property, the lower level may provide additional bedrooms, bathrooms, recreation areas, office space or storage.
A property may have a separate entrance, second kitchen, basement bedrooms, additional laundry or independently arranged lower-level living space. These features do not establish that the property contains a legal or approved secondary suite.
Renovated Coventry Hills bungalows for sale can vary considerably in the scope and age of completed improvements. Cosmetic updates should be assessed separately from structural work, basement development and major building systems.
A visually updated home may still contain older major components. Buyers may want to review the apparent age and condition of roofing, windows, exterior finishes, heating equipment, hot-water systems, electrical service and plumbing.
An appropriate professional property inspection may also be considered before removing applicable purchase conditions.
Garage descriptions provide only a general indication of parking configuration. Buyers with larger vehicles, storage needs or workshop requirements should confirm actual dimensions.
The outdoor property can affect maintenance, usability and future plans. Compare lot configuration and condition rather than relying only on advertised lot dimensions.
Buyers should review title information and an available Real Property Report where applicable to understand property boundaries, registered interests and improvements located on the parcel.
Permits or compliance information may also be relevant for additions, decks, fences, sheds or other exterior improvements.
